logo

情感化语音合成:从技术萌芽到智能交互的演进之路

作者:宇宙中心我曹县2025.09.23 11:09浏览量:0

简介:本文梳理情感化语音合成技术从规则驱动到深度学习的演进脉络,分析关键技术突破与产业应用场景,为开发者提供技术选型与落地实践指南。

情感化语音合成:从技术萌芽到智能交互的演进之路

一、技术萌芽期:规则驱动的情感参数控制(1990s-2005)

在语音合成技术发展的早期阶段,情感表达主要通过人工设计的规则系统实现。研究者通过分析语音的声学特征(基频、时长、能量)与情感状态的映射关系,构建显式参数控制模型。例如,1999年Cahn提出的情感语音生成框架,将情感类型(愤怒、快乐、悲伤等)映射到声学参数的调整范围:

  1. # 伪代码示例:基于规则的情感参数调整
  2. def apply_emotion_rules(base_speech, emotion):
  3. params = {
  4. 'happy': {'pitch': +20%, 'duration': -10%, 'energy': +15%},
  5. 'angry': {'pitch': +30%, 'duration': +20%, 'energy': +25%},
  6. 'sad': {'pitch': -15%, 'duration': +15%, 'energy': -20%}
  7. }
  8. adjusted_params = {k: base_speech[k] * (1 + v) for k, v in params[emotion].items()}
  9. return synthesize_with_params(adjusted_params)

该阶段技术存在明显局限:情感类型依赖人工标注,参数调整规则缺乏普适性,合成语音的自然度仅能达到60-70分(MOS评分)。2003年东京工业大学开发的”EMOVOICE”系统,虽能实现5种基本情感合成,但需要专业语音学家参与参数调优,难以规模化应用。

二、数据驱动时期:统计建模与情感标注体系(2006-2015)

随着机器学习技术的发展,情感语音合成进入数据驱动阶段。研究者开始构建大规模情感语音数据库,如ESD(Emotional Speech Dataset)包含100小时、250种情感状态的录音。统计参数合成(SPSS)技术通过决策树、高斯混合模型(GMM)等算法,建立声学特征与情感标签的映射关系。

2012年提出的隐马尔可夫模型(HMM)情感合成框架,将情感状态作为隐变量融入声学模型训练:

  1. 状态空间 = {愤怒, 快乐, 中性, 悲伤, 恐惧}
  2. 观测特征 = [MFCC, F0, 能量, 语速]
  3. 训练目标 = 最大化P(观测特征|情感状态)

该阶段技术突破在于:通过情感标注数据实现自动参数学习,合成自然度提升至75-80分。但问题依然存在:情感表达过于单一,跨语言迁移能力差,且需要大量标注数据(每类情感需5000+句样本)。

三、深度学习革命:端到端情感建模与多模态融合(2016-2020)

2016年WaveNet的出现标志着深度学习在语音合成领域的全面应用。研究者开始构建端到端的情感语音合成模型,直接从文本和情感标签生成波形。2018年提出的Tacotron 2+GST架构,通过全局风格标记(Global Style Tokens)实现无监督情感学习:

  1. # 简化版GST模型结构
  2. class GSTEncoder(tf.keras.Model):
  3. def __init__(self, num_tokens=10):
  4. super().__init__()
  5. self.reference_encoder = BiLSTM(128)
  6. self.style_tokens = tf.Variable(tf.random.normal([num_tokens, 128]))
  7. def call(self, ref_mel):
  8. ref_emb = self.reference_encoder(ref_mel) # [B,128]
  9. attn_weights = tf.nn.softmax(tf.matmul(ref_emb, self.style_tokens, transpose_b=True)) # [B,10]
  10. style_emb = tf.matmul(attn_weights, self.style_tokens) # [B,128]
  11. return style_emb

该阶段技术呈现三大特征:1)情感表达细腻度显著提升,MOS评分达85-90分;2)支持细粒度情感控制(如从1到10的兴奋度调节);3)开始融合文本语义与声学特征的多模态建模。2020年微软提出的FastSpeech 2+情感嵌入方案,将情感控制延迟降低至50ms以内,满足实时交互需求。

四、智能化阶段:上下文感知与个性化适配(2021-至今)

当前技术发展聚焦三大方向:1)上下文感知的情感生成,通过Transformer架构捕捉对话历史中的情感演变;2)个性化情感适配,基于用户历史交互数据构建专属情感模型;3)多模态情感表达,同步控制语音、面部表情和肢体语言。

2023年OpenAI提出的EmotionGPT框架,将情感语音合成与大语言模型结合:

  1. 用户输入:"用开心的语气讲述这个悲伤的故事"
  2. 处理流程:
  3. 1. LLM理解情感矛盾性 生成情感调节指令
  4. 2. 情感编码器生成动态风格标记
  5. 3. 声码器输出融合矛盾情感的语音
  6. 输出结果:表面欢快但带有隐含悲伤的复杂情感表达

该阶段技术挑战在于:1)情感与语义的解耦与融合;2)低资源场景下的情感迁移;3)伦理与隐私保护(如避免情感操纵)。最新研究显示,结合对比学习的自监督预训练方法,可在10分钟标注数据下达到90%的原有性能。

五、开发者实践指南

  1. 技术选型建议

    • 实时交互场景:优先选择FastSpeech 2系列模型(推理速度<100ms)
    • 高保真需求:采用Parallel WaveGAN等神经声码器
    • 细粒度控制:集成GST或参考编码器模块
  2. 数据构建策略

    • 基础数据集:建议收集5000句/情感类别的标注数据
    • 增强方案:采用语音变换(pitch shifting, speed perturbation)提升数据多样性
    • 隐私保护:使用差分隐私技术处理用户个性化数据
  3. 评估指标体系

    • 客观指标:MCD(梅尔倒谱失真)<4.5dB,F0 RMSE<20Hz
    • 主观指标:MOS评分>4.2(5分制),情感识别准确率>85%

六、未来技术趋势

  1. 情感计算融合:结合脑电信号、微表情等多模态情感输入
  2. 低资源学习:发展少样本/零样本情感迁移技术
  3. 伦理框架构建:建立情感语音合成的使用边界与规范标准

当前,情感化语音合成技术已从实验室走向商业应用,在智能客服数字人教育娱乐等领域产生显著价值。开发者需持续关注模型效率优化、多语言支持、情感真实性提升等关键方向,以构建更具人文关怀的智能交互系统。

相关文章推荐

发表评论